Shinichiro Hagihara (萩原慎一郎, September 16, 1984-June 8, 2017) is a Japanese poet. The author of "Kashu Kassoro"(Tanka poetry collection "Runway", 歌集滑走路) which became a best-selling book of tanka in the Heisei era. The book was also made into a movie in 2020.

life[edit]

Early life[edit]

Born in 1984 in Ogikubo, Suginami-ku, Tokyo. After moving to Nagaokakyo City in Kyoto Prefecture and Hong Kong during the period of British rule for his father's work, he moved to Kodaira City, Tokyo. In 1997, he entered Musashi Junior High School, a private junior high and high school for boys in Nerima Ward, Tokyo, which is also known as the three boys' junior high schools, and joined the baseball club. In that experience, at the age of 17, he started writing tanka, inspired by the poet Machi Tawara, who happened to come to a nearby bookstore at a book publishing event co-authored with Wahei Tatematsu[1][2]. Early literary career[edit]

17-year-old Shinichiro Hagihara (2002) attending the Meiji Memorial Tanka Tournament

Since 2002, he has participated in the Tanka Association "Tou", which was presided over by Kazuhiro Nagata, and at the same time he started to apply for various competitions. He has won many awards including the Tanka Competition Japan Poetry Club Award. At that time, he was introduced with a tanka as a 17-year-old notable poet in the 2002 association magazine "Teen / Twenties Poet Special" of "Tower". In 2004, it was published by Koyo Shobo in "Pickles no kimochi", which is a compilation of the winning works of SEITO Hyakunin Isshu, a high school tanka competition sponsored by Doshisha Women's University.

At the age of 19, he participated in the Future Tanka[3][4], which was presided over by Takashi Okai, and the poetry held by various poets.

After graduating from Musashi High School, he suffered from the aftereffects of bullying, but he graduated from Waseda University's Faculty of Human Sciences while being hospitalized and going to the hospital. When I was a university student, I studied tanka, and my graduation thesis was about Shuji Terayama, who is known for his avant-garde tanka[5]. In 2010, he was selected as the final candidate for the Contemporary Short Song Review Award.

After graduating from university, he continued to create tanka while working as a non-regular employee such as a part-time job at a bookstore or a contract employee at a research institution. In 2014, he received the 5th Kadokawa National Tanka Award Semi-Award and the 1st Yoshimi Kondo Award (Takashi Okai Selection) of the NHK National Tanka Tournament. In 2015, he won the Asahi Kadan Award and the All Japan Tanka Tournament Mainichi Newspaper Award. The following year, in 2016, his work was selected as a special selection at the NHK National Tanka Tournament, and he won the second Japanese Tanka Club Award at the All Japan Tanka Tournament. Received the Yoshimi Kondo Award for the second time in 2017. Background to the publication of "Kashu Kassoro"[edit]

The publication of "Kashu Kassoro" was decided in 2017, and in May, the writing was completed and the manuscript of the postscript was submitted to the editorial department of the Kadokawa Culture Promotion Foundation. It is said that the title, cover, and composition of the book were all decided by himself. However, he died on June 8, 2017 due to continued mental illness caused by being bullied for a long time[7][8]. Year of enjoyment 32. In Kadokawa Tanka Magazine, a memorial tanka by Takayuki Saegusa was published, and on SNS, poets such as Kosaku Okumura, who had a friend in his lifetime, made regrettable voices[9]. In addition, a memorial to Sumi Konno was published in the September 2017 issue of the Tanka Association magazine "Ritomu" of the Tanka Association.

"Kashu Kassoro" that was about to be published was taken over by the bereaved family, and preparations were made for publication such as Kenya Hagihara, a younger brother and guitarist, conducting full publicity activities on SNS etc., and the official schedule will be on December 13th[10]. Was announced on Twitter, and "Tanka Poetry Collection" was published by the Kadokawa Culture Promotion Foundation on December 25, 2017, and was released on the Kadokawa Shoten label on December 26[11].

In the field of tanka, unlike general book publishing methods, it is customary for the author to publish at his own expense regardless of award history or name recognition, and the circulation is at most 100 to 500[12][13], but tanka and haiku The first edition of 1500 copies was published by the bereaved family at their own expense under the support of the Kadokawa Culture Promotion Foundation[14], which is a public interest foundation that supports the project. Published "Kashu Kassoro"[edit]

"Kashu Kassoro" is a collection of many awards and contributions to magazines, and was originally the first songbook by Shinichiro Hagihara, who is well known in the short song industry. It became a hot topic shortly after its release, and after being introduced in the evening edition of the Asahi Shimbun on February 19, 2018, it became popular all at once and was reprinted eight times in less than a year. With a circulation of 30,000, it was featured in major newspapers such as "News Watch 9" (NHK G), Kadokawa Tanka, "Da Vinci" (KADOKAWA)[15], and Mainichi Shimbun, as well as multiple media such as television, radio, and magazines. .. Also, on October 16th, it was featured in "Close-up Gendai +" (NHK G) as an exceptional hit with a circulation of 200 times that of a regular tanka collection[16]. At the same time, it was announced that there were more than 2000 tanka songs not recorded in "Utashu Runway".

Movie and high school textbook[edit]

On March 25, 2020, "Runway" was made into a movie under the co-production of Kadokawa Daiei Studio and SKIP City, which is jointly funded by Saitama Prefecture, NHK, NTT Communications, etc. It was announced that it would be done[19]. The director will be Norichika Oba, and Kodai Asaka, Asami Mizukawa, Uta Yorikawa, Shota Sometani, Maki Sakai, Kaito Yoshimura, Kenji Mizuhashi, Kei Kinoshita, and Yuto Ikeda will appear.

On September 24, 2020, Kadokawa released a paperback book of "Runway" and a novelized version of the movie. The commentary on the postscript of the paperback book was newly written by Akutagawa Prize-winning author Naoki Matayoshi. The movie "Runway", which was originally written on November 3, was selected as a special invitation film for the Tokyo International Film Festival. The movie was released to the public on November 20, and won the Best Actress Award at the Kinema Junpo Best Ten and Yokohama Film Festival, and was nominated for the Announcement Film Award for Best Film and the Mainichi Film Contest New Face Award. On November 23, "Tanka Poetry Collection" was introduced in Tensei Jingo of the Asahi Shimbun, and it won the first place in the Rakuten Books literature category[22].
